BJP leadership in  UP discusses poll setback

  • | Wednesday | 5th June, 2024

In the wake of a stunning setback in the recent  Lok Sabha elections, the core leadership of the  Bharatiya Janata Party held an emergency  meeting at the residence of Uttar Pradesh Chief  Minister Yogi Adityanath. The meeting, attended by Deputy Chief  Ministers Keshav Prasad Maurya and Brajesh  Pathak, along with BJP state president  Bhupendra Chaudhary, sought to address the  partys electoral setback. The BJP, in coalition with its allies, suffered a  significant blow, managing to secure only 39  Lok Sabha seats against the 64 it won last time.  This marked a stark decline from its previous  performance, as the party and its allies lost 25  seats in the elections. "The meeting underscored the urgency for  introspection within the BJP ranks, with leaders  grappling to analyse the root causes of their  electoral setback. The discussions centred on  reassessing the partys strategies and rectifying  the shortcomings in its organisational  machinery," a senior leader told this reporter. The defeat in the Lok Sabha elections has sent  shock waves across the BJP leadership,  prompting a concerted effort to regroup and  recalibrate their approach ahead of future  electoral battles. As the party navigates through  this period of introspection, the focus remains on  revitalising its grassroots machinery and  rekindling the trust of the electorate. "The outcome of the emergency meeting signals  the beginning of a critical phase for the BJP in  Uttar Pradesh, as it seeks to reclaim lost ground  and rejuvenate its electoral prospects in the  state," the leader said. Former Congress leader Pramod Krishnam  openly blamed the BJPs organisational  deficiencies for the defeat. In a statement  Krishnam criticised the party workers for their  failure to mobilise voters effectively and ensure  their turnout at the polling booths.
